CoGe can analyze chromatin immunoprecipitation sequence (ChIP-seq) using the software package Homer.

See the LoadExperiment tool to use the new pipeline.

This analysis pipeline was developed by Xiang Ju (in the lab of Brian Gregory at UPenn).

Inputs

Three FASTQ input files are required:

  • input
  • two replicates

Workflow

  1. Trim FASTQ files (optional)
  2. Align FASTQ files to reference genome sequence -- these steps depend on which alignment software tool is selected (GSNAP, Bowtie, etc)
    1. Build index of reference sequence
    2. Individually map FASTQ files to reference
